Analysis

South Asia recorded 320,875 current US$ per square kilometre for industry (including construction), value added (current us$), per in 2023. That is the highest value across all 63 years on record.

The figure is up 5.6% on the previous year and up 80.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, industry (including construction), value added (current us$), per in South Asia peaked at 320,875 current US$ per square kilometre in 2023 and was at its lowest, 2,710 current US$ per square kilometre, in 1961.

That places South Asia 9th out of 47 groups with data for 2023, putting it in the top qu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ated

Industry (including construction), value added (current US$) div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.

Industry (including construction), value added (current US$) ÷ Land area (sq. km)
